Self Empty Robot Vacuum Mop Review

A self-emptying robot vacuum mop is a great way to keep your floors clean. The base station automatically emptys the dust bin and refills the mop tank between cleaning cycles. It also manages other maintenance tasks like charging and washing mop pads.

It makes use of a powerful bristle as well as AI-powered obstacles avoidance. However, it doesn't perform as well on carpets. It also has trouble maneuvering over tassels.

A self-emptying robotic mop and vacuum is a fantastic investment for busy households, because it can save time and energy by handling multiple chores at once. They can also be used on a daily basis to keep your floors tidy and ready for family and guests. These are great for homes with children, pets or other messy mess.

Unlike robotic vacuums, which require manual emptying Self-emptying robots automatically get rid of the dirty mop pads. They also wash and dry your floors for you.
